Ukraine Solidarity Campaign Humanitarian mission to the frontline regions
Four volunteers of the Ukraine Solidarity Campaign have driven over 1,900 miles to the frontline Donbas region of Ukraine with two buses packed with aid for the 10th Paramilitary Mining Rescue Squad in Donetsk Oblast. The vehicles were converted for us in rescue operations. Russian state targets Ukraine solidarity campaign
A Russian authority — the Federal Service for Supervision in the Sphere of Telecom, Federal Service for Supervision of Communications, Information Technology and Mass Media (ROSKOMNADZOR) have issued a demand to Internet website hosting company WordPress to remove the website of UK-based Ukraine Solidarity Campaign (USC).
